Overview

Alexandre Dumas, Pere, best known for his adventure novels, delves into the dark heart of post-Revolutionary France in ""Massacres of the South."" This historical account explores the tumultuous period following the French Revolution, a time rife with crime, political violence, and massacres. Dumas meticulously documents the events, offering readers a chilling glimpse into the brutal realities of the era. A significant contribution to the study of French history, ""Massacres of the South"" examines the specific instances of uprisings and rebellions that plagued the region. It provides a detailed exploration of the crime and political upheaval that characterized this period. Readers interested in European history, particularly the French Revolution and its aftermath, will find this book to be a compelling and informative resource. This gripping true crime narrative sheds light on a often overlooked chapter of French history.
